"Helped my journey as a mother"

About: Leeds General Infirmary / Maternity care

(as the patient),

I gave birth at the LGI in September 2016. The care I received was second to none. It was absolutely fantastic, especially from staff on ward 36. I was struggling to breastfeed and my baby wouldn't latch for hours and hours but the girls persevered and kept me from being anxious about baby being hungry. They had plenty of time to support me whenever I needed them to and always went the extra mile to teach me how to feed my baby. If it weren't for them, I wouldn't be breastfeeding now. You girls are worth your weight in gold. As a first time mummy, you honestly helped my journey as a mother get off to the right start and I can't thank you enough.

The only thing I feel could be improved was the food.
